Job description

To provide comprehensive HIV counselling to clients, their families, Community members and to mobilize and support communities to respond to the HIV epidemic.
Specific duties and responsibilities
1. Provide Quality and Comprehensive Counselling Services to Clients, their partners and other
family members (Pre-test, Post-test, Adherence support, Intensive Adherence Counselling).
2. Conduct assessment of Patients for HTS and provide necessary psychosocial care.
3. Participate in the process of empowering patients with skills for self-reliance and making appropriate succession plans.
4. Conduct CMEs at the facility and community based on the assessed training needs.
5. Provide technical support to facility and community volunteers on HIV/AIDS and TB awareness
and document success stories.
6. Conduct health education talks on HIV prevention and other HIV related issues.
7. Conduct home visits to clients/patients and their family members.
8. Offer Index client counselling & testing to house members of facility clients she/he is attached
too.
9. Support linkage Volunteers in linking clients to appropriate Health & Social Services.
10. Document key outputs in the relevant MOH data capture tools.
11. Compile weekly, monthly, and quarterly reports for the facilities supported on key HIV/AIDS and
TB indicators.
12. Participate in facility and program meetings as may be scheduled by the supervisor.
Minimum qualifications, and Job requirements.
• Diploma in Nursing, Counselling from a recognized institution.
• At least 1 years’ experience in HIV counseling in a busy clinical setting.

Mentorship, Counseling, and Communication skills.
• Must be willing to travel and provide care services at selected health facilities and outreaches.
• Willingness to work and live in rural areas is required.
• Special knowledge in the management of adverse events following circumcision and its related
complication.
• Confidentiality, team player and ability to empathize.
• Ability to communicate in the language dialects used in East Central region (Lusoga, Lugweri,
Swahili, Samia, Luganda)
